The cost to repair a garage door varies widely based on the issue and parts required. A simple fix like replacing a single torsion spring typically ranges from $150 to $350, while a full spring replacement can cost $200 to $400. Repairing or replacing a garage door opener averages between $150 and $350. For more complex problems like broken panels, cables, or tracks, costs can escalate from $200 to $600 or more. Labor rates and geographic location also significantly impact the final price. For reliable service, it's best to get a detailed, written estimate from a professional. The most common problem with garage doors is a failure of the automatic opener system, often due to issues with the safety sensors or a disconnected drive mechanism. These sensors, located near the floor on either side of the door, can become misaligned or dirty, preventing the door from closing. Other frequent issues include broken springs, which bear the door's immense weight, and worn or off-track rollers. Regular visual inspections and lubrication of moving parts can prevent many common failures.
